Salary Range: $130,000 to $200,000 + EquityAbout Phase3D:We are developing computer vision technology which performs in-situ monitoring for industrial 3D printing (additive manufacturing, AM). This technology dramatically changes the metal AM industry by providing immediate component certification and early cancellation of defective builds. Our vision is to provide the additive manufacturing industry with a trusted method to validate part quality in real time.The Phase3D headquarters is in Chicago, located 5 miles from the Chicago Loop. We work closely with federal scientists and engineers to develop machine vision technology for additive manufacturing (camera and software based).
